
MGolf Finishes in Eighth at Towson
4/3/2013 12:00:00 AM | Men's Golf
Finishing only one stroke worse than Wilson, JT Harper (Pebble Beach, Calif.) tied for 30th place overall with a 17-over-par, 77-78-78-233.
Junior Gary Dunne (Wicklow, Ireland) finished three strokes behind Harper with a 20-over-par, 80-77-79-236 to tie for 44th place overall.
David Cha (Carrollton, Texas) had a rough third round after leading the Pirates with the low score through the first two rounds. He finished at 22-over-par with a 77-76-85-238, and tied for 49th place overall.
Kamaal Khatumal (Sierra Leone, West Africa) rounded out the Pirates’ scoring with a 32-over-par, 82-82-84-248 for the tournament.
Seton Hall will return to the links in two weeks for the Princeton Invitational at Springdale Golf Club in Princeton, N.J., April 13-14.
